Future Developments in Data Analysis with Python
Looking ahead, the future of data analysis with Python is filled with exciting possibilities. One of the emerging trends is the use of Automated Machine Learning (AutoML) frameworks, which simplify the process of building and deploying ML models. Tools like H2O.ai and TPOT automate the model selection and hyperparameter tuning, making ML more accessible to non-experts.
Another area of growth is the application of Python in Internet of Things (IoT) data analysis. As more devices become connected, the volume of IoT data is increasing exponentially. Python's ability to handle real-time data streams and perform edge computing makes it a valuable tool for IoT data analysis.
